Pre Start-Up Check List Start-Up Procedure
No Freight Damage (Components Tight, Straight,
Etc.).
Check That All Applicable Warning Decals Are In
Their Proper Place And Are Legible.
Proper Belt Alignment And Tensions.
The ATS Engine Start Wires and other DC Wires,
if Any, Must be Properly Connected.
Flex Fuel Lines Installed Between Engine And
Tank.
All Wiring Connections are Tight.
Fluid Levels (Oil, Antifreeze, Battery, Governor,
Etc.) Check For Leaks, Tighten As Necessary.
The Equipment Room is Clean & All Unrelated
Materials Removed.
Correct Fuel And Exhaust Plumbing.
The Equipment is Protected from Possible Fire
Damage by Fire Extinguisher System.
Adequate Air Flow.
Earthquake Protection (when Applicable) is
Adequate for the Equipment.
Correct AC Wire Sizes And Connections.
Open Generator Mainline Breaker or Remove
Fuses.
Correct DC Wire Sizes And Connections (Route
Separate From AC).
Turn Down Speed Potentiometer (Electronic
Governor) or Speed Screw (Mechanical
Governor).
Block Heater Is Operational.
Move Switch to "Manual". let the Engine Start &
Run.
Bleed And Prime The Fuel System; Check For
Leaks. Correct As Necessary.
After a Few Minutes, Check Oil Pressure & Check
for Leaks.
On Natural Gas Fueled Sets, Gas Pressure Of 4-6
Oz. Of Pressure With Adequate Volume Is
Available.
Adjust the Speed to 60/50hz if Equipped with
Electronic Governor or 63/53 Hz with Mechanical
Governor.
Gas Solenoid Valve Is Properly Functioning.
If Speed is Unstable, Adjust Per Engine or
Governor Manual.
Exhaust Line and Flexible Connections are
Properly Installed Without Excessive Bends and
Restrictions.
Adjust the AC Voltage to Match the Normal
Source.
Exhaust System Termination Properly Located to
Prevent Entry of Exhaust Gas Into Building.
Let the Unit Run Until Engine Reaches Proper
Water Temp.
Batteries Properly Filled with Electrolyte &
Properly Connected to the Engine.
Close Generator Mainline Breaker or Replace
Fuses..
Battery Charger Must Be Properly Installed &
Connected to the Battery. Battery Must Be Fully
Charged Prior to Start-up.
Manually Over-Speed the Unit Until Engine
Shutdown (68-70 Hz or 60 Hz Generators ; 58-60
Hz on 50 Hz Generator Sets.
Generator Load Connectors of Proper Ampacity
are Connected to Either the Circuit Breaker or the
Emergency Side of the Transfer Switch.
Test Automatic Shut-Downs (Low Oil Pressure,
Low Coolant Level, High Coolant Temperature,
Overspeed set to ______Hz Other______)
The Nameplate Voltage & Frequency of the
Genset Matches that of ATS & Normal Source.
**INSTRUCT END USER ON FUNCTIONS OF
UNIT***. Set Times to Customer's Request and
Run a Simulated Power Outage.
Instruct the Customer in Proper Operation &
Maintenance of the System and Make Sure They
Have Correct Manuals.
